Elite Brisbane college evacuated after fire in classrooms

Queensland Fire and Emergency Services were called to the college about 11.40am after a fire broke out in the design and technology classrooms.Students and staff were evacuated, the college posted on its Facebook page.“(The fire) occurred during break time, when no students were in the location, and following the college assembly which all students attended,” the Facebook post read.“The Queensland fire department was called immediately and the fire alarms activated. “All students and staff…
